Taiwan-based semiconductor foundry TSMC announced that it will invest $34 billion to expand the production volume of 2nm process chips on June 5 with approval from the local administration for land rent, Taiwan media outlet UDN reported. Last October, the firm announced plans to realize mass production of 2nm process chips by 2025. Meanwhile, the CEO of TSMC, Wei Zhejia, told UDN in April that the firm would have the 3nm process ready for mass production in the second half of this year. [UDN, in Chinese]
